LAKEWOOD, NJ - Due to inclement weather across the Jersey Shore, Sunday's Delmarva Shorebirds-Lakewood BlueClaws game has been postponed.
Because the Shorebirds don't visit Lakewood again until the second half, the game will most likely be made up in Salisbury as part of a doubleheader when the BlueClaws visit next Thursday through Sunday, or during the series May 25-28. The makeup will be announced at a later date.
The Shorebirds now move on to Hagerstown to open a three-game series against their in-state rivals. Zac Lowther (1-0, 0.00) will now make the start against the Suns' Nick Raquet (0-1, 3.27). First pitch on Monday is set for 6:05 p.m., and pregame coverage on Fox Sports 960 AM and the MiLB First Pitch app begins at 5:50 with Will DeBoer on the call.
